This event is designed for 18 to 31+ year olds. It is part social, part science, part environmental volunteering.
Join Amy (Friends of the Helmeted Honeyeater Youth Reference Group Convenor), and Sue & Rachel (FoHH citizen science program), who will share the species data collection procedures we use for plants, frogs and birds. No prior experience needed.
We’ll make our way to a location in Yellingbo Nature Conservation Area that people are rarely invited to. Our session will focus on collecting baseline data at a site where Monash University will be undertaking future reptile surveys and FoHH are planning habitat restoration. What species are currently present in this site? We’ll use iNaturalist to contribute to the 2023 Melbourne Biodiversity Blitz that's happening in September, whilst gaining some transferable industry knowledge and skills, as we learn from each other and enjoy being out in the bush together.
Our activities operate within a gated and locked Conservation Area and we move away from the entry point for our event. We will be using a 4WD to carpool close to the survey site. You'll need to be able to commit to the arrival/start times listed. Registrations close 24 hours before the event.
